Tottenham Hotspur survived a late Aston Villa onslaught to record a 3-1 win at White Hart Lane.
Spurs were comfortable for much of the game, thanks to goals from Mousa Dembele and Dele Alli inside the opening 45 minutes.
Villa were given a lifeline 10 minutes from time when substitute Jordan Ayew found a way through, but despite their best efforts to rescue a point Harry Kane killed off any hope in the dying stages with a late third for his side.
